Concept introduction:
Energy is defined as the capacity to do work. It is associated with both physical and chemical changes.
The two types of energy are as follows:
1. Potential energy: It is the energy due to the position of the object relative to the other objects.
2. Kinetic energy: It is the energy that arises due to the motion of the objects.
Stability is inversely related to potential energy and therefore higher the potential energy lower will be the stability.
